Research Services

Genealogy research services helps you trace their family history by uncovering ancestral records, building family trees, and interpreting historical documents. These services often use public archives, DNA data, and specialised databases to provide detailed insights into your heritage.

Heritage Tours

Heritage tours offer a unique opportunity to walk in your ancestors’ footsteps, visiting the towns, homes, and landmarks in Belgium, that shaped your family’s story. These personalised journeys bring your research to life, creating a deep and meaningful connection to your family and roots.

Story Writing

If you’re ready to turn your family history into a treasured keepsake, I can help you craft a meaningful story in the format of your choice, whether it’s a PDF, e-book, photo book with text, or a full biography. Together, we’ll bring your ancestors’ stories to life for future generations to enjoy.
